OpenClaw用户如何快速接入Taotoken平台并使用聚合模型
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
OpenClaw用户如何快速接入Taotoken平台并使用聚合模型
对于使用OpenClaw进行Agent工作流开发的开发者而言,直接对接多个大模型厂商的API往往意味着繁琐的密钥管理、不同的调用规范以及分散的计费统计。Taotoken平台通过提供统一的OpenAI兼容API,将多家主流模型聚合在一个接口之下,让开发者可以更专注于Agent逻辑本身。本文将基于官方文档,详细说明如何将OpenClaw配置为使用Taotoken平台,并快速开始你的开发工作。
1. 准备工作:获取Taotoken API Key与模型ID
在开始配置之前,你需要准备好两个核心信息:Taotoken平台的API Key和你希望使用的模型ID。
首先,访问Taotoken控制台并创建一个API Key。这个Key将作为你所有模型调用的统一凭证。其次,在平台的“模型广场”中,浏览并选择你需要的模型。每个模型都有一个唯一的模型ID,例如claude-sonnet-4-6或gpt-4o-mini。请记录下你选定的模型ID,在后续配置中会用到。
请妥善保管你的API Key,避免泄露。建议在环境变量或配置文件中引用,而非直接硬编码在代码里。
2. 理解OpenClaw与Taotoken的对接方式
OpenClaw作为一款Agent开发工具,其底层通常通过OpenAI SDK与模型服务进行通信。Taotoken平台提供了完全兼容OpenAI的API接口,这意味着对接方式与使用原厂OpenAI API几乎一致,核心区别在于需要修改两个配置项:base_url(API端点地址)和model(模型标识)。
对于Taotoken平台,OpenAI兼容接口的base_url应设置为https://taotoken.net/api。你的API请求将通过这个统一的网关被路由到你所指定的具体模型。而model参数则直接使用你在模型广场看到的ID,平台会自动识别并转发。
3. 使用Taotoken CLI一键配置OpenClaw
手动修改配置文件虽然可行,但为了提升效率并避免配置错误,Taotoken提供了官方的命令行工具@taotoken/taotoken来帮助你快速完成配置。
首先,你需要安装这个CLI工具。你可以选择全局安装以便随时使用:
npm install -g @taotoken/taotoken
或者,你也可以使用npx直接运行,无需安装:
npx @taotoken/taotoken
安装完成后,运行taotoken命令,你会看到一个交互式菜单。选择与OpenClaw相关的配置选项。更直接的方式是使用为OpenClaw设计的子命令。以下是一键配置的示例思路,你需要将占位符替换为你的实际信息:
taotoken openclaw --key YOUR_TAOTOKEN_API_KEY --model YOUR_MODEL_ID
你也可以使用简写命令oc:
taotoken oc -k YOUR_TAOTOKEN_API_KEY -m YOUR_MODEL_ID
执行此命令后,CLI工具会自动向OpenClaw的配置文件中写入必要的设置。这通常包括将提供方(provider)的baseUrl设置为https://taotoken.net/api/v1,并将Agent的默认主模型设置为taotoken/<你的模型ID>的格式。具体写入的配置项和格式,请以执行命令后的实际输出或OpenClaw的官方文档为准。
4. 验证配置与开始开发
配置完成后,建议编写一个简单的测试脚本来验证连接是否正常。你可以创建一个Python文件,使用OpenAI SDK进行测试:
from openai import OpenAI
# 客户端会自动读取OpenClaw配置或你设置的环境变量
# 确保base_url指向Taotoken,api_key已正确配置
client = OpenAI(
api_key="你的Taotoken_API_Key", # 建议从环境变量读取
base_url="https://taotoken.net/api",
)
try:
completion = client.chat.completions.create(
model="claude-sonnet-4-6", # 替换为你的模型ID
messages=[{"role": "user", "content": "你好,请回复‘连接成功’。"}],
)
print("响应内容:", completion.choices[0].message.content)
print("模型调用成功!")
except Exception as e:
print("连接测试失败:", e)
运行这个脚本,如果看到正确的回复内容,说明从OpenClaw到Taotoken平台的链路已经打通。之后,你就可以像平常一样在OpenClaw中设计Agent工作流,所有的模型调用都会通过Taotoken平台完成,无需再关心不同模型厂商的密钥和端点差异。
通过以上步骤,你已将OpenClaw成功接入Taotoken平台。接下来,你可以在Taotoken控制台中统一管理API调用、查看所有模型的用量分析和费用明细,实现更高效的开发与运维管理。
开始你的聚合模型开发之旅,请访问 Taotoken 创建密钥并查看模型列表。
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
更多推荐
所有评论(0)